A plant, a fleet, a fab, a data center, a team: it exists before the volume that fills it, because it has to. Nobody builds after the orders arrive. So the wait between the capacity existing and the demand arriving is the structure of the decision rather than a failure of planning, and what separates the outcomes is whether anybody priced it. The argument in the room is always about whether the demand will come, which nobody can settle, so the meeting becomes about conviction while the meter runs. This pack turns that into two divisions. Carrying cost over contribution per unit gives break-even volume, and as a share of capacity, the utilization at which the asset stops losing money — set against the utilization you run at. Committed funding over what a year of waiting costs gives the carry: how many years of waiting the money covers, set against how long the demand needs at the growth rate the plan already assumes. The gap between those is the decision, and its width matters more than its sign. It stops on five conditions: no carrying cost, no capacity figure, no contribution per unit, nothing stated about what is arriving, and no funding committed to the wait.
